On average across the year,
no, Sweden is not hotter than
Irvine, California
.
Sweden has an average temperature of 7°C/45°F and Irvine, California has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F.
Sweden's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 22°C/72°F, which is not hotter than Irvine, California's hottest month (August,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F).
On average across the year, yes, Sweden is colder than Irvine, California . Sweden has an average minimum temperature of 3°C/37°F and Irvine, California has an average minimum temperature of 14°C/57°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Sweden has more rain than
Irvine, California. Sweden has an average annual rainfall of 488mm and Irvine, California has an average annual rainfall of 245mm.
Sweden's wettest month is August, with an average monthly rainfall of 57mm, which is drier than Irvine, California's wettest month (December, with an average monthly rainfall of 61mm).
